Web14 mrt. 2024 · Spring water is water that is harvested from a natural spring. Unlike many forms of bottled water that are filtered and treated to remove impurities, water from a natural spring is considered to contain a beneficial level of minerals and is normally bottled directly at the source.

Web9 aug. 2011 · When Perrier first started bottling the effervescent water in the early 20th century, the company took the liquid straight from a spring called Les Bouillens (or "The Bubbles") in Vergèze, France.
